Understanding Business Intelligence
Business Intelligence is the process of transforming raw data into actionable insights for organizations. It involves collecting, analyzing, and interpreting data to help organizations make data-driven decisions. The importance of Business Intelligence cannot be overstated in today's data-driven world.
In today's fast-paced and highly competitive business landscape, organizations are constantly seeking ways to gain a competitive advantage. This is where Business Intelligence comes into play. By leveraging data, organizations can identify patterns, trends, and opportunities that can help them make informed decisions. Business Intelligence allows companies to optimize their operations, improve efficiency, and drive growth.
Imagine a retail company that wants to understand the buying behavior of its customers. By utilizing Business Intelligence, the company can analyze customer data to identify which products are most popular, what factors influence purchasing decisions, and how to effectively target different customer segments. Armed with this knowledge, the company can tailor its marketing strategies, optimize inventory management, and ultimately increase sales and customer satisfaction.

Core Concepts in Business Intelligence
At Villanova, you will learn the fundamental concepts of Business Intelligence. These include data analysis, data visualization, data mining, and business analytics. You will also gain knowledge in data warehousing, business intelligence architecture, and predictive modeling. These concepts are the foundation for a successful career in Business Intelligence.
Data analysis is a crucial aspect of Business Intelligence as it involves examining large datasets to uncover meaningful insights. By utilizing various statistical techniques and algorithms, analysts can identify trends, correlations, and anomalies in the data. This information can then be used to make informed decisions and drive business growth.
Data visualization is another key concept in Business Intelligence. It involves representing data in a visual format, such as charts, graphs, and dashboards, to facilitate understanding and interpretation. Visualizing data allows decision-makers to quickly grasp complex information and identify patterns or trends that may not be immediately apparent in raw data.
Data mining is the process of discovering patterns and relationships in large datasets. By applying advanced algorithms and techniques, analysts can extract valuable insights from the data that may not be readily apparent through traditional analysis methods. This can uncover hidden opportunities, improve operational efficiency, and drive innovation within an organization.
Business analytics is the practice of using data and statistical methods to drive business performance. It involves analyzing historical and current data to identify trends, predict future outcomes, and make data-driven decisions. By leveraging business analytics, organizations can gain a deeper understanding of their operations, identify areas for improvement, and develop strategies to achieve their goals.
Data warehousing is the process of storing and organizing large volumes of data in a centralized repository. This allows organizations to efficiently manage and access their data, ensuring that it is accurate, consistent, and readily available for analysis. A well-designed data warehouse forms the foundation for effective Business Intelligence, enabling organizations to derive insights from their data in a timely and efficient manner.
Business intelligence architecture refers to the infrastructure and systems that support the collection, storage, analysis, and dissemination of data within an organization. It encompasses hardware, software, databases, and other components that are necessary for effective Business Intelligence. A robust and scalable architecture is essential for organizations to leverage their data effectively and derive maximum value from their Business Intelligence initiatives.
Predictive modeling is a powerful technique used in Business Intelligence to forecast future outcomes based on historical data. By analyzing past trends and patterns, analysts can develop models that can predict future behavior or events. This enables organizations to anticipate market changes, identify potential risks, and make proactive decisions to stay ahead of the competition.

Data Warehousing and Business Intelligence Architecture
Data warehousing and business intelligence architecture are essential components of Business Intelligence. You will learn how to design and develop data warehouses, extract-transform-load (ETL) processes, and create effective data models. Understanding the architecture behind Business Intelligence systems is critical to their successful implementation and utilization.

Expected Salary and Job Growth
Business Intelligence professionals are in high demand, and this trend is expected to continue in the coming years.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ual salary for business intelligence analysts was $87,780 as of May 2020. The job growth in this field is projected to be much faster than the average for all occupations.
